- [ ] Telemetry compression rollout (Pinewire). Confirm zstd payloads decode on all collector tiers; legacy Marrow agents fall back to gzip. Bench numbers from the Quillback cluster show 61% size reduction, no CPU regression. Needs sign-off from platform before the flag flips fleet-wide. Candidate build is the token below.

build token for fajof-yahof: htk4_869f

Subject: Spare hardware storage — access for contractors

Hi all,

Quick note from the front desk at Thornbury Works. The spare hardware room is on Level 1, just past the lift lobby — look for the grey door marked "Stores." Please sign the kit log on the shelf inside whenever you take or return anything, even cables. Don't leave the door wedged open; it locks itself and we've lost two doorstops to it already. While you're on site this week, you can get in with the code below.

badge for fafop-fajof: bdg-Z-47

Capacity note for Shelfwright catalog caching: invalidation bursts after bulk price imports can exceed 40k keys/sec, which overwhelms the purge queue if consumers lag. We shard purges by category prefix and apply a token bucket per shard. If you see purge latency above 30s during an import, throttle the importer first, not the cache. The shard-level constants are set as follows.

tuning table, kahop-fahog:
RATE_LIMITS = {
    "wenix": 1,
    "druael": 10,
    "holix": 1,
    "zorael": 1,
}

Prepared for heads of department.

Marrowvale Industries will divest Fernhollow Logistics to Copestone Partners. Rationale: persistent margin erosion and capital reallocation toward the Ashgrove automation programme. Terms: cash consideration plus earn-out over two years. Staff consultation begins next month; department heads must hold communications until then. Legal review is near complete. Risks: customer attrition, transitional IT costs. The confidential plan summary is set out immediately below.

management briefing: Project Ulavan slips by two quarters because of the staffing delay.